The Sarpy County Board approved a special-use permit June 30 to allow a commercial recreation area on about 71.18 acres southwest of 87th Street and Kawi Drive in the unincorporated county.
Planning Director Robert Loroko presented the request on behalf of Long Island Gravel Company, describing the site as already developed with four cabins, several well housings operated under agreement with the City of Pilion, and an existing private firearms range. The applicant proposed one additional cabin and revised the cabin location after city review to avoid wetlands and well housings. "The request complies with the requirements of the Sarpie County zoning ordinance," Loroko said, recommending approval with conditions, including floodplain-elevation requirements.
No members of the public spoke during the hearing. Commissioners questioned whether the existing structures could serve as emergency shelter during severe weather; staff said the use is limited to cabins that operate like single-family residences and that the applicant submitted a required operations plan and emergency-operations plan addressing flood events and evacuation procedures. The Pilion Gun Club provided a letter of concurrence for the revised cabin location.
The board moved and approved the special-use permit with the conditions noted in the staff recommendation. The approval requires compliance with floodplain-development regulations and the submitted emergency-operations plan.
County officials noted the site sits in an AE flood zone and that any construction must meet floodplain-elevation and other regulatory requirements before occupancy.
